Darp Facts
| Area | 0.1 km² |
| Population | 268 |
| Male Population | 134 (49.9%) |
| Female Population | 134 (50.1%) |
| Population change (1975 to 2020) | +44.9% |
| Population change (2000 to 2020) | +97.1% |
| Median Age | 47.6 years (Male: 46.8, Female: 48.4) |
| Area Codes | 521 |
| Local Time | |
| Timezone | Central European Summer Time |
| Lat & Lng | 52.77500, 6.20417 |
| Postal Codes | 7973 |

Darp
Darp is a town in the Dutch province of Drenthe. It is a part of the municipality of Westerveld, and lies about 19 km west of Hoogeveen. 2001, the town of Darp had 507 inhabitants. The built-up area of the town was 0.17 km², and contained 189 reside..
